Computer-Aided Drafting

OBJECTIVES

After reading this chapter, you will be able to

  • Draw straight lines, curved lines, arcs, circles, polygons, ellipses and elliptical arcs without using drawing instruments
  • Prepare accurate drawings of machine parts and enlarge, reduce, copy and rotate them
  • Change the type, thicknesses, and color of symbolic lines, and erase any selected line
  • Dimension drawings to describe the size of the object perfectly
